    Rangers owner Criag Whyte has revealed that the club were not willing to listen to offers for their first choice keeper from Villa or any other club. The Scotland international has long been touted as a target for Villa and was thought to have been rated highly by the previous management, with rumours suggesting that McLeish would push through with their liking of the stopper in order to replace veteran Brad Friedel after the new boss claimed a new number 1 was the main priority in the transfer window.
